It's really hard to say whether or not the upgrade would be worth it. There aren't a lot of new features and functions that I know of that you will get. Mostly it will be addresses and points of interest (businesses) and maps that are 3 years more up to date than what you have. (v4 assuming that is what is in your car vs v7). If you get the latest that was mentioned, v 9, you be jumping approx 5 years. Whether that matters or not depends on how you use your system and whether or not there has been a lot of new development in the areas where you drive.
My experience has been the newest version is usually about $200 to $250 and agree with Anita that Sewell usually has a very comptetitive price. you can buy older versions (like 6 or 7) on ebay for a lot less. Be sure you are getting a factory original, not a copy.
You also want to be sure that you buy the right generation dvd for your car. nav generation refers to the hardware. dvd v9 or v7 etc, come in generation 3, 4 or 5 depending on the year of your car. I'm pretty sure your 04 is gen3 navi. Sewell parts online has a chart you can look at to verify.
